1. Choose Your Pellets The type of wood pellets you choose will significantly affect the flavor of your food. Popular choices include hickory, mesquite, applewood, and cherry. Each wood imparts a different flavor, so experiment to find your favorite.

One of the most appealing features of the tripod grill stand is its height-adjustable capability. This allows users to position the grill at their desired level, whether they want the flames close for quick searing or further away for slow cooking. This level of control over your cooking environment can significantly enhance your culinary creations.
One of the most significant advantages of using a tripod cooking grate is its portability. Most models are lightweight and easy to assemble, making them perfect for camping trips or backyard barbecues. Simply pack it in your gear, set it up over an open fire, and you’re ready to cook up a feast. This ease of use allows for spontaneous cooking experiences, where you can share delicious meals with family and friends around the campfire.

In the world of culinary arts, organization and efficiency are paramount. One often overlooked but essential tool in many kitchens is the half sheet rack. These racks are designed to accommodate half sheet pans, a standard size in both commercial and home kitchens. Measuring approximately 13 by 18 inches, half sheet pans are incredibly versatile, and their associated racks provide various benefits that enhance both food preparation and presentation.
